From http://en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Let_It_Be_Me_%28song%29:
"Let It Be Me" is a popular song originally published in 1955 as "Je t'appartiens". The score was written and first recorded by Gilbert Bécaud. The lyrics were penned in French by Pierre Delanoë. The English language version used lyrics by Mann Curtis and was performed in 1957 by Jill Corey in the television series Climax!. Corey's version, with orchestration by Jimmy Carroll, was released as a single and was moderately successful. The most popular version of "Let It Be Me" was released in 1960 by The Everly Brothers. It reached 7th position on the Billboard Hot 100.[1] The harmony arrangement of this version was often emulated in subsequent remakes. |

100 YEARS AGO TODAY: April 24, 1916 -
Ernest Shackleton and five men of the
Imperial Trans-Antarctic Expedition launched a lifeboat from
uninhabited
Elephant Island in the
Southern Ocean to organize a rescue for the crew of the sunken
Endurance.

April 24,
1916 -
Easter Rising:
Irish republicans, led by
Patrick Pearse and
James Connolly, launched an uprising against British rule in
Ireland, and
proclaimed an Irish Republic. It was the first armed action of the
Irish revolutionary period.
April 24, 1933 -
Nazi
Germany began its
persecution of Jehovah's Witnesses by shutting down the
Watch Tower Society office in
Magdeburg.
